Mkhondo farmers’ bail application to continue on Tuesday
Updated | By Sinethemba Madolo
The bail application of the five men accused of killing the Coka brothers was adjourned in the Piet Retief Magistrate’s Court in Mkhondo on Monday.
The fifth suspect Zenzele Patrick Yende (48) was arrested on Thursday and appeared briefly at the same court on Friday.
Brothers Zenzele and Mgcini Coka were brutally killed last week.
They were allegedly shot by local farm owners.

All five suspects are facing charges of kidnapping, attempted murder, two counts of murder and defeating the ends of justice.
Spokesperson for the National Prosecuting Authority (NPA) in Mpumalanga Monica Nyuswa says Yende has been linked to the cases faced by the initial suspects.
The suspects will return to court on Tuesday for the continuation of their bail hearing.
